OK, I have to use sposies when I take dd to childcare, and I have not had good experiences with Tushies. So I am at the local health food store, and I see there is a new brand of "natural" disposables called Nature Boy and Girl. The bag says they are all natural, and they are compostable. The outer layer is made of corn starch rather than plastic. So I think, great, they will probably still end up in a landfill somewhere, but at least there will be no harmful chemicals in contact with my daughter's skin.

Anyway, dd is home from childcare, and I have just changed her out of her sposie into her nice soft cotton diaper, and I decide to open the sposie to see what's inside. Guess what I found? Gel balls!! I was so disappointed! Could it be "all natural" gel? How could that be compostable? Does anyone know what that stuff is?
